package libpython_clj.jna;
import com.sun.jna.*;
import java.util.*;
// typedef PyObject * (*unaryfunc)(PyObject *);
// typedef PyObject * (*binaryfunc)(PyObject *, PyObject *);
// typedef PyObject * (*ternaryfunc)(PyObject *, PyObject *, PyObject *);
// typedef int (*inquiry)(PyObject *);
// typedef Py_ssize_t (*lenfunc)(PyObject *);
// typedef PyObject *(*ssizeargfunc)(PyObject *, Py_ssize_t);
// typedef PyObject *(*ssizessizeargfunc)(PyObject *, Py_ssize_t, Py_ssize_t);
// typedef int(*ssizeobjargproc)(PyObject *, Py_ssize_t, PyObject *);
// typedef int(*ssizessizeobjargproc)(PyObject *, Py_ssize_t, Py_ssize_t, PyObject *);
// typedef int(*objobjargproc)(PyObject *, PyObject *, PyObject *);
// typedef int (*getbufferproc)(PyObject *, Py_buffer *, int);
// typedef void (*releasebufferproc)(PyObject *, Py_buffer *);
/* Maximum number of dimensions */
// #define PyBUF_MAX_NDIM 64
// /* Flags for getting buffers */
// #define PyBUF_SIMPLE 0
// #define PyBUF_WRITABLE 0x0001
// /* we used to include an E, backwards compatible alias */
// #define PyBUF_WRITEABLE PyBUF_WRITABLE
// #define PyBUF_FORMAT 0x0004
// #define PyBUF_ND 0x0008
// #define PyBUF_STRIDES (0x0010 | PyBUF_ND)
// #define PyBUF_C_CONTIGUOUS (0x0020 | PyBUF_STRIDES)
// #define PyBUF_F_CONTIGUOUS (0x0040 | PyBUF_STRIDES)
// #define PyBUF_ANY_CONTIGUOUS (0x0080 | PyBUF_STRIDES)
// #define PyBUF_INDIRECT (0x0100 | PyBUF_STRIDES)
// #define PyBUF_CONTIG (PyBUF_ND | PyBUF_WRITABLE)
// #define PyBUF_CONTIG_RO (PyBUF_ND)
// #define PyBUF_STRIDED (PyBUF_STRIDES | PyBUF_WRITABLE)
// #define PyBUF_STRIDED_RO (PyBUF_STRIDES)
// #define PyBUF_RECORDS (PyBUF_STRIDES | PyBUF_WRITABLE | PyBUF_FORMAT)
// #define PyBUF_RECORDS_RO (PyBUF_STRIDES | PyBUF_FORMAT)
// #define PyBUF_FULL (PyBUF_INDIRECT | PyBUF_WRITABLE | PyBUF_FORMAT)
// #define PyBUF_FULL_RO (PyBUF_INDIRECT | PyBUF_FORMAT)
// #define PyBUF_READ 0x100
// #define PyBUF_WRITE 0x200
// /* End buffer interface */
// #endif /* Py_LIMITED_API */
// typedef int (*objobjproc)(PyObject *, PyObject *);
// typedef int (*visitproc)(PyObject *, void *);
// typedef int (*traverseproc)(PyObject *, visitproc, void *);
// typedef struct {
// /* Number implementations must check *both*
// arguments for proper type and implement the necessary conversions
// in the slot functions themselves. */
// binaryfunc nb_add;
// binaryfunc nb_subtract;
// binaryfunc nb_multiply;
// binaryfunc nb_remainder;
// binaryfunc nb_divmod;
// ternaryfunc nb_power;
// unaryfunc nb_negative;
// unaryfunc nb_positive;
// unaryfunc nb_absolute;
// inquiry nb_bool;
// unaryfunc nb_invert;
// binaryfunc nb_lshift;
// binaryfunc nb_rshift;
// binaryfunc nb_and;
// binaryfunc nb_xor;
// binaryfunc nb_or;
// unaryfunc nb_int;
// void *nb_reserved; /* the slot formerly known as nb_long */
// unaryfunc nb_float;
// binaryfunc nb_inplace_add;
// binaryfunc nb_inplace_subtract;
// binaryfunc nb_inplace_multiply;
// binaryfunc nb_inplace_remainder;
// ternaryfunc nb_inplace_power;
// binaryfunc nb_inplace_lshift;
// binaryfunc nb_inplace_rshift;
// binaryfunc nb_inplace_and;
// binaryfunc nb_inplace_xor;
// binaryfunc nb_inplace_or;
// binaryfunc nb_floor_divide;
// binaryfunc nb_true_divide;
// binaryfunc nb_inplace_floor_divide;
// binaryfunc nb_inplace_true_divide;
// unaryfunc nb_index;
// binaryfunc nb_matrix_multiply;
// binaryfunc nb_inplace_matrix_multiply;
// } PyNumberMethods;
// typedef struct {
// lenfunc sq_length;
// binaryfunc sq_concat;
// ssizeargfunc sq_repeat;
// ssizeargfunc sq_item;
// void *was_sq_slice;
// ssizeobjargproc sq_ass_item;
// void *was_sq_ass_slice;
// objobjproc sq_contains;
// binaryfunc sq_inplace_concat;
// ssizeargfunc sq_inplace_repeat;
// } PySequenceMethods;
// typedef struct {
// lenfunc mp_length;
// binaryfunc mp_subscript;
// objobjargproc mp_ass_subscript;
// } PyMappingMethods;
// typedef struct {
// unaryfunc am_await;
// unaryfunc am_aiter;
// unaryfunc am_anext;
// } PyAsyncMethods;
// typedef struct {
// getbufferproc bf_getbuffer;
// releasebufferproc bf_releasebuffer;
// } PyBufferProcs;
// #endif /* Py_LIMITED_API */
// typedef void (*freefunc)(void *);
// typedef void (*destructor)(PyObject *);
// #ifndef Py_LIMITED_API
// /* We can't provide a full compile-time check that limited-API
// users won't implement tp_print. However, not defining printfunc
// and making tp_print of a different function pointer type
// should at least cause a warning in most cases. */
// typedef int (*printfunc)(PyObject *, FILE *, int);
// #endif
// typedef PyObject *(*getattrfunc)(PyObject *, char *);
// typedef PyObject *(*getattrofunc)(PyObject *, PyObject *);
// typedef int (*setattrfunc)(PyObject *, char *, PyObject *);
// typedef int (*setattrofunc)(PyObject *, PyObject *, PyObject *);
// typedef PyObject *(*reprfunc)(PyObject *);
// typedef Py_hash_t (*hashfunc)(PyObject *);
// typedef PyObject *(*richcmpfunc) (PyObject *, PyObject *, int);
// typedef PyObject *(*getiterfunc) (PyObject *);
// typedef PyObject *(*iternextfunc) (PyObject *);
// typedef PyObject *(*descrgetfunc) (PyObject *, PyObject *, PyObject *);
// typedef int (*descrsetfunc) (PyObject *, PyObject *, PyObject *);
// typedef int (*initproc)(PyObject *, PyObject *, PyObject *);
// typedef PyObject *(*newfunc)(struct _typeobject *, PyObject *, PyObject *);
// typedef PyObject *(*allocfunc)(struct _typeobject *, Py_ssize_t);
/**
PyObject size: 16
PyTypeObject size: 400
type.tp_basicsize: 32
type.tp_as_number: 96
type.tp_as_buffer: 160
type.tp_finalize: 392
**/
public class PyTypeObject extends PyObject
{
public long ob_size;
public Pointer tp_name; /* For printing, in format "<module>.<name>" */
/* For allocation */
public long tp_basicsize;
public long tp_itemsize;
/* Methods to implement standard operations */
public CFunction.tp_dealloc tp_dealloc;
public Pointer tp_print;
public CFunction.tp_getattr tp_getattr;
public CFunction.tp_setattr tp_setattr;
public Pointer tp_as_async; /* formerly known as tp_compare (Python 2)
or tp_reserved (Python 3) */
public CFunction.NoArgFunction tp_repr;
/* Method suites for standard classes */
public Pointer tp_as_number;
public Pointer tp_as_sequence;
public Pointer tp_as_mapping;
/* More standard operations (here for binary compatibility) */
public CFunction.tp_hash tp_hash;
public CFunction.KeyWordFunction tp_call;
public CFunction.NoArgFunction tp_str;
public CFunction.tp_getattro tp_getattro;
public CFunction.tp_setattro tp_setattro;
/* Functions to access object as input/output buffer */
public Pointer tp_as_buffer;
/* Flags to define presence of optional/expanded features */
public int tp_flags;
public Pointer tp_doc; /* Documentation string */
/* Assigned meaning in release 2.0 */
/* call function for all accessible objects */
public Pointer tp_traverse;
/* delete references to contained objects */
public Pointer tp_clear;
/* Assigned meaning in release 2.1 */
/* rich comparisons */
public CFunction.tp_richcompare tp_richcompare;
/* weak reference enabler */
public long tp_weaklistoffset;
/* Iterators */
public CFunction.NoArgFunction tp_iter;
public CFunction.NoArgFunction tp_iternext;
/* Attribute descriptor and subclassing stuff */
public PyMethodDef.ByReference tp_methods;
public PyMemberDef.ByReference tp_members;
public PyGetSetDef.ByReference tp_getset;
public Pointer tp_base;
public Pointer tp_dict;
public Pointer tp_descr_get;
public Pointer tp_descr_set;
public long tp_dictoffset;
public CFunction.tp_init tp_init;
public Pointer tp_alloc;
public CFunction.tp_new tp_new;
public CFunction.tp_free tp_free; /* Low-level free-memory routine */
public Pointer tp_is_gc; /* For PyObject_IS_GC */
public Pointer _bases;
public Pointer tp_mro; /* method resolution order */
public Pointer tp_cache;
public Pointer tp_subclasses;
public Pointer tp_weaklist;
public Pointer tp_del;
/* Type attribute cache version tag. Added in version 2.6 */
public int tp_version_tag;
public Pointer tp_finalize;
public static class ByReference extends PyTypeObject implements Structure.ByReference {}
public static class ByValue extends PyTypeObject implements Structure.ByValue {}
public PyTypeObject () {}
public PyTypeObject (Pointer p ) { super(p); read(); }
protected List getFieldOrder() { return Arrays.asList(new String[]
{
"ob_refcnt",
"ob_type",
"ob_size",
"tp_name", /* For printing, in format "<module>.<name>" */
/* For allocation */
"tp_basicsize",
"tp_itemsize",
/* Methods to implement standard operations */
"tp_dealloc",
"tp_print",
"tp_getattr",
"tp_setattr",
"tp_as_async", /* formerly known as tp_compare (Python 2)
or tp_reserved (Python 3) */
"tp_repr",
/* Method suites for standard classes */
"tp_as_number",
"tp_as_sequence",
"tp_as_mapping",
/* More standard operations (here for binary compatibility) */
"tp_hash",
"tp_call",
"tp_str",
"tp_getattro",
"tp_setattro",
/* Functions to access object as input/output buffer */
"tp_as_buffer",
/* Flags to define presence of optional/expanded features */
"tp_flags",
"tp_doc", /* Documentation string */
/* Assigned meaning in release 2.0 */
/* call function for all accessible objects */
"tp_traverse",
/* delete references to contained objects */
"tp_clear",
/* Assigned meaning in release 2.1 */
/* rich comparisons */
"tp_richcompare",
/* weak reference enabler */
"tp_weaklistoffset",
/* Iterators */
"tp_iter",
"tp_iternext",
/* Attribute descriptor and subclassing stuff */
"tp_methods",
"tp_members",
"tp_getset",
"tp_base",
"tp_dict",
"tp_descr_get",
"tp_descr_set",
"tp_dictoffset",
"tp_init",
"tp_alloc",
"tp_new",
"tp_free", /* Low-level free-memory routine */
"tp_is_gc", /* For PyObject_IS_GC */
"_bases",
"tp_mro", /* method resolution order */
"tp_cache",
"tp_subclasses",
"tp_weaklist",
"tp_del",
/* Type attribute cache version tag. Added in version 2.6 */
"tp_version_tag",
"tp_finalize"
}); }
}
